Cultural differences don't only exist across national boundaries. Important differences exist right here in the United States. We could name several of them, but let's take a look at what Cohen et al. (1996) termed the "Southern Culture of Honor."

These authors were curious about one regional difference. In some Southern and Western regions, merely insulting a man can be punishable by death. As one wag styled it, "In the South, ‘He done needed killin' is a viable defense in a murder trial."

Cohen et al. (1996) conducted four experiments. In one of them, an assistant called a series of male subjects "an a--hole" in a contrived situation that made the insult seem both real and plausible. Most subjects from the North laughed it off ; "Same to you, buddy." Most of those from the South responded with various degrees of anger. In some cases, the experimenters had to intervene to save their assistant getting a black eye.

Cohen et al. explained the results in terms of traditional culture that was brought to this country from the rocky slopes of Scotland, in the 18th century. There, a man's flock (sheep or cattle) was his life. Life was hard. Any threat, either real or perceived, had to be taken care of, and promptly.
